I need a translation of this: 'YANIMDAYSAN KIYMETİNİ ; UZAGIMDAYSAN HADDINI BILECEKSIN !'

Disclaimer: I have no idea what does it mean. There can be s-words. I don't want to offend anyone.

Something like:

"You shall know your value/how much you mean, if you are near me; your boundaries/the line drawn before you, if you are away from me".

Haddini bilmek means: knowing one's place, knowing that one should not overstep, one should not cross the line....
